#abac63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abac63 is composed of 67.1% red, 67.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 60.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 53.1%. #abac63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#575900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#abac63 color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.
#abac63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#abac63 has RGB values of R:171, G:172,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11250787.

Shades and Tints of #abac63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a06 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#abac63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90907f is the less saturated color, while #fbff10 is the most saturated one.
